
Nayanabhirama Udupa
Medical and Health Sciences / Pharmacy & Pharmaceutical Sciences
AD Scientific Index ID: 411789
मणिपाल यूनिवर्सिटी
person_outline
Nayanabhirama Udupa's MOST POPULAR ARTICLES